Merchants who open stores on Amazon will definitely come across terms such as replenishment limits and warehouse capacity. In fact, they can reflect how merchants manage the inflow of new inventory and the use of physical space in the operation center. So what is the difference between Amazon's replenishment limits and warehouse capacity? Next, we will explain this to you. 1. Replenishment limits and storage limits are two different limits. The former is used to manage the inflow of inventory, while the latter is used to manage the actual space usage of the operation center. 2. Replenishment limits are calculated based on historical sales and forecasted demand for both the seller and the specific ASIN. The maximum number of shipments we can send is equal to the maximum inventory level allowed, minus the inventory limit usage. 3. Storage limits are related to our Inventory Performance Index score, which measures our ability and efficiency to manage our existing FBA inventory. What to do about Amazon's storage capacity limitations? 1. Request for a position increase Amazon reviews storage limits every month. If you have sold 8% or more of your inventory each week for the past 9 weeks, you are eligible for an increase. Sellers can also contact Amazon Seller Support to request an increase. 2. Increase sales rate Amazon will assess the sales rate of your inventory products within 90 days. The higher the sales capacity and order level, the higher the sales rate, and the lower the inventory limit. 3. Deal with inventory backlog Dealing with inventory backlogs and clearing inventory during seasonal changes is an important part of inventory management. Sellers can choose to use official clearance promotion tools to effectively help reduce inventory pressure. For example, a limited-time (usually 2 weeks) promotional offer on the Outlet page is a promotional means of clearing backlogs, which can help sellers effectively increase exposure and quickly clear backlogs! Sellers can also use the inventory management tools provided by Amazon Logistics (FBA) to clean up redundant and idle inventory in a timely manner, and then recover the value of goods, freeing up space for new and popular products to enter the warehouse during the peak season. For example, Amazon Logistics' bulk clearance plan can quickly process inventory that was originally planned to be abandoned or destroyed. As long as an order is successfully created, storage capacity can be released immediately, and the value of goods can be recovered at a price of 5%-20%. Merchants should not panic when they encounter storage capacity restrictions. We can take the above methods to remedy the situation and resolve the problem caused by storage capacity restrictions.
